Book Description: Multifunctional CementBased Sensors for Intelligent Concrete Infrastructure Design Fabrication and Application In today's rapidly evolving technological landscape, it is essential to stay abreast of the latest advancements in the field of engineering and construction. One such area that has seen significant progress is the development of multifunctional cementbased sensors for monitoring the health and durability of concrete infrastructure. This groundbreaking book, "Multifunctional CementBased Sensors for Intelligent Concrete Infrastructure Design Fabrication and Application delves into the design, fabrication, and application of these innovative sensors, providing a comprehensive overview of their capabilities and potential for improving the safety and longevity of bridges, buildings, and roads.
